                SUMMARY OF PROVISIONS OF THE RESOLUTION

    The resolution provides for consideration of H.R. 5461, the 
Iranian Leadership Asset Transparency Act, under a structured 
rule. The resolution provides one hour of general debate 
equally divided and controlled by the chair and ranking 
minority member of the Committee on Financial Services. The 
resolution waives all points of order against consideration of 
the bill. The resolution provides that the bill shall be 
considered as read. The resolution waives all points of order 
against provisions in the bill. The resolution makes in order 
only those amendments printed in this report. Each such 
amendment may be offered only in the order printed in this 
report, may be offered only by a Member designated in this 
report, shall be considered as read, shall be debatable for the 
time specified in this report equally divided and controlled by 
the proponent and an opponent, shall not be subject to 
amendment, and shall not be subject to a demand for division of 
the question in the House or in the Committee of the Whole. The 
resolution waives all points of order against the amendments 
printed in this report. The resolution provides one motion to 
recommit with or without instructions.

                SUMMARY OF THE AMENDMENTS MADE IN ORDER

    1. Poliquin (ME): MANAGER'S Adds Committee on Foreign 
Affairs to the reporting requirements in the Bill. (10 minutes)
    2. Young (IN): Adds three additional provisions to the 
bill's required report on Iranian leadership financial assets. 
(10 minutes)
    3. Lance (NJ): Adds head of Atomic Energy Organization of 
Iran to list of Iranian leaders. (10 minutes)

2. An Amendment To Be Offered by Representative Young of Indiana or His 
                   Designee, Debatable for 10 Minutes

  Page 7, line 7, strike ``and''.
  Page 7, line 13, strike the period and insert a semicolon.
  Page 7, after line 13, insert the following:
          (5) recommendations for how U.S. economic sanctions 
        against Iran may be revised to prevent the funds or 
        assets described under this subsection from being used 
        by the natural persons described in subsection (b) to 
        contribute to the continued development, testing, and 
        procurement of ballistic missile technology by Iran;
          (6) a description of how the Department of the 
        Treasury assesses the impact and effectiveness of U.S. 
        economic sanctions programs against Iran; and
          (7) recommendations for improving the ability of the 
        Department of the Treasury to rapidly and effectively 
        develop, implement, and enforce additional economic 
        sanctions against Iran if so ordered by the President 
        under the International Emergency Economic Powers Act 
        or other corresponding legislation.
